Suspect sketch released in Krabi massacre

Police have released a facial sketch of a possible suspect in Monday’s massacre of a village headman and seven members of his family in Krabi.The sketch, based on a survivor’s description of the assailant, shows a young man wearing a cap.
He is wanted in connection with the murder of Worayuth Sunglung and seven members of his family and the wounding of three other family members.
Police are checking surveillance recordings from CCTV cameras along the route the assailants are believed to have used when fleeing the scene, and from others around the Tambon Ban Klang Administrative Organisation office a kilometre away.
The assailants made off with a computer hard drive also containing a recording of Worayuth’s house.
Police are looking for two black Toyota Fortuner SUVs seen passing back and forth in front of the house on the eve of the attack.
